Output 12e0a7589d2fe79018a8edbd377d698b51fc43aa5792bbd9a8b15a49429af96e:1

value
17748
script pubkey
OP_0 OP_PUSHBYTES_20 2e8180265a126d87b03d3d7e53cabe90345798b5
address
bc1q96qcqfj6zfkc0vpa84l98j47jq690x94zmuled
transaction
12e0a7589d2fe79018a8edbd377d698b51fc43aa5792bbd9a8b15a49429af96e
spent
true